Scope and Contents note

Scope and Contents note
Photographs relating to Edward Francis Witz's time as a Peace Corps volunteer in Bayankhongor, Mongolia. Witz's photographs depict his host family, the yurt in which he lived, and Witz wearing a del (a traditional Mongolian garment) made by his host mother.

Custodial History note
Possibly donated to the National Museum of Natural History in accession 2031194. Transferred to the National Anthropological Archives in 2005.
